Myrtaceae Juss.
Ristantia pachysperma (F.Muell. & F.M.Bailey) Peter G.Wilson & J.T.Waterh.
, legitimate, scientific
[Wilson, Peter G. & Waterhouse, J.T. (1982), A review of the genus Tristania R.Br. (Myrtaceae): a heterogeneous assemblage of five genera. Australian Journal of Botany 30(4)]:
443
[comb. nov.]
basionym:
Xanthostemon pachyspermus F.Muell. & F.M.Bailey
legitimate
nomenclatural synonym:
Tristania pachysperma (F.Muell. & F.M.Bailey) W.D.Francis
legitimate
taxonomic synonym:
Tristania odorata C.T.White & W.D.Francis
legitimate
